Types of Crypto Wallets

1. Hardware Wallets

A hardware wallet is a physical device that stores your private keys offline, making them less vulnerable to cyber attacks. These wallets are perfect for those who prioritize security over accessibility and are willing to spend a little extra for it. Some popular hardware wallets include Trezor, Ledger Nano S, and KeepKey.

2. Software Wallets

Software wallets are applications that you can download on your computer or smartphone. These wallets are accessible and easy to use but are more vulnerable to cyber-attacks. They are great for those who are new to cryptocurrencies and not ready to invest in a hardware wallet yet. Some popular software wallets include Exodus, MyEtherWallet, and Trust Wallet.

3. Web Wallets

Web wallets are online platforms that store your private keys on their servers. These wallets are the least secure as you have to trust the third-party to keep your assets safe. However, they are convenient and accessible from anywhere with an internet connection. Some popular web wallets include Coinbase, Binance, and BitGo.

Factors to Consider When Choosing a Crypto Wallet

1. Security

Security should be your top priority when selecting a crypto wallet. Ensure that the wallet you choose offers top-notch security features, such as two-factor authentication and multi-sig protection.

2. User Experience

Pick a wallet that has a user-friendly interface and is easy to use. You don’t want to be fumbling around with a complicated interface when you want to buy or sell your assets quickly.

3. Supported Coins

Each wallet supports different coins, so make sure the wallet you choose supports the coins you plan on investing in.

4. Fees

Fees can vary between wallets, so make sure to do your research to find a wallet with reasonable fees that fit your budget.

5. Customer Support

In case you encounter an issue with your wallet, it’s essential to have a reliable customer support team to assist you. Look for wallets with excellent customer support and responsiveness.
